Osho calls the incomparable Dhammapada sutras of Buddha, "the book of books." He explains that these sutras are concerned with every aspect of man's unawareness, and that Buddha's whole message is devoted to the raising of our consciousness. To enter into the Dhammapada with Osho is to witness a deep friendship of enlightened masters. These sutras were compiled by Buddha's disciples to contain the essence of all his teachings. This was the last turning of the Wheel of Dharma, 2,500 years ago. Osho's commentaries on these sutras set the Wheel of Dharma in motion again. Osho also answers questions from disciples and other seekers in alternate discourses all generously sprinkled with stories, personal anecdotes and, of course, a multitude of jokes.

Later published as part of Osho Books on CD-ROM.
Later published as part of The Dhammapada, namely, The Dhammapada, Series 4
time period of Osho's original talks/writings
August 22, 1979 to August 31, 1979 : timeline
number of discourses/chapters
10

The Book of the Books, Vol 4

Discourses on The Dhammapada of Gautam the Buddha

Year of publication : 1985
Publisher : Rajneesh Foundation International
ISBN 0-88050-516-8 (click ISBN to buy online)
Number of pages : 349
Hardcover / Paperback / Ebook : P
Edition notes : First edition: July 1985 - 10,000 copies. Copyright © 1985 Rajneesh Foundation International.
Size : 177.8 x 108 x 20 mm
Author as Bhagwan Shree Rajneesh
Published by: Bodhisattvaa Ma Anand Sheela M.M., D.Phil.M., D.Litt.M.(RIMU), Acharya
Editor: Ma Krishna Prabhu
Design: Ma Prem Bhava
Direction: Sambodhi Ma Yoga Pratima, M.M., D.Phil.M.(RIMU), Arihanta
The sutras used in this book are from THE DHAMMAPADA: THE SAYINGS OF BUDDHA, translated by Thomas Byrom. Text ©1976 Thomas Byrom.
